Can totally relate to how you are feeling and the anger reactions. It all has to do with all the other feelings that you are not identifying that lead up to the anger outbursts. I'm guilty of the same thing. Seems like I learnt from a young age to suppress all the bad feelings like humiliation, sadness, hurt, self doubt, etc instead of acknowledging them and dealing with them. When they present as anger it's confusing because you can't understand why sometimes small triggers make you fly off the handle. I understand it now and now I have a long road ahead of me to try and be more conscious about my feelings at the time I feel them rather than disregarding them and having them all fuse together as anger. I have printed off a list of emotions to refer to since there so many and often it's hard to find the word for the feeling. Good luck and don't worry your not alone.
